One day only for charities to salvage Electric Picnic discarded tents

Clearout underway in an Electric Picnic Campsite.

Charities and salvage groups are going to have a brief window to clear any reusable tent equipment at Electric Picnic.
There are multiple vast campsites at the Laois festival which took place over the weekend of August 16 to 19, with tens of thousands of people camping there.
The Electric Picnic MD told the Leinster Express / Laois Live that they cannot give charites much time.
"We try to do it within a 24 hour window, we don't want people here for very long. Just that first afternoon and evening.
"We try and give people that salvage operation where we can but at that point we have to get focussed on the clear out for Thomas and the local landowners."
His advice to departing campers is blunt.
"Take everything. Leave nothing for the salvagers, take everything that you arrived with apart from the beer which I presume you drank.
"People don't, we have to tidy up, we have a separation system to separate what's recyclable and what's not.Try and be as tidy as you would be at home," he said.
Portlaoise Action to Homelessness (PATH) volunteers will be allowed on site picking through the waste to find sleeping bags, tents and equipment to help the homeless. Last year they gathered some 500 sleeping bags. 
They are holding a sleeping bag washing day on Thursday, August 22, in Laois Shopping Centre, where the public volunteer to take, wash and return the bags.
